Calories in Korean Style Sesame 100% Grass-Fed Beef Sirloin Tips, Korean Style Sesame

📏 Serving Size: 1 Serving (112.0g)

🧪 Nutrition Facts

Amount Per Serving
  • Calories 160.2
  • Total Fat 6.0 g
  • Saturated Fat 1.5 g
  • Cholesterol 60.5 mg
  • Sodium 600.3 mg
  • Potassium 0.0 mg
  • Total Carbohydrate 3.0 g
  • Dietary Fiber 0.0 g
  • Sugars 2.0 g
  • Protein 23.0 g

📝 Ingredients

Beef, Water, Seasoning (sea Salt, Natural Flavor, Dried Vinegar). Rubbed with: Seasonings (sesame Seed, Cane Sugar, Dehydrated Tamari Soy Sauce [tamari Soy Sauce, {soybeans, Salt}, Maltodextrin, Salt] Spices, Ginger, Chives, Brown Sugar, Dehydrated Garlic and Onion, Champignon Mushroom Powder), Sesame Oil.
